> > looking at the output of
> > 
> > nm tests/unit/.libs/test_urcu_multiflavor :
> > 
> >                  U __tls_access_rcu_reader
> > 
> > seems to be the issue. We're missing macro expansion in tls-compat.h. With
> > the patch attached:
> > 
> >                  U __tls_access_rcu_reader_bp
> >                  U __tls_access_rcu_reader_mb
> >                  U __tls_access_rcu_reader_memb
> >                  U __tls_access_rcu_reader_sig
> > 
> > which should fix your issue. Can you try it out and let me know if it fixes
> > your problem ?

> Extra question (Paul ? Adding lttng-dev in CC):
> 
> Please note that this affects an unusual configuration of userspace RCU
> (with TLS pthread key fallback), needed for some BSD that don't support
> compiler TLS. Strictly speaking, this should require bumping the URCU
> library soname version major number, because it breaks the ABI presented
> to applications on those unusual configurations. However, since this is
> only for unusual configurations, I wonder if we should bump the soname
> version major number or not ? If we do need to bump the soname, can we
> really do this in a stable version fix (0.7, 0.8), or do we need to push
> a 0.9 out and document the limitation for 0.7 and 0.8 ?

If it doesn't work on those unusual configurations now, it is hard to
argue that they are broken by the change.  ;-)

So I advocate leaving the major number the same and putting out the
bug fix.

> > > It seems to be another object file/static data issue. When it works with
> > > rcu_reader, it first initializes it (pthread_key_create) from liburcu.2,
> > > but
> > > latter stacks come from liburcu-bp.2.
> > > I ran it in debugger with breakpoints at pthread_key_create(),
> > > pthread_getspecific(), pthread_setspecific(). Each hit I recorded key
> > > numbers, values, etc. First time a library assigns the key number 0x103,
> > > second time 0x104.
